feat: Support relays and naddrs sets

This commit introduces support for 'sets', a feature that simplifies
referencing multiple relays or naddrs with a single word.

Sets are stored in the config directory under `n34` as `config.toml` in
`TOML` format. The config path follows the `$XDG_CONFIG_HOME` standard,
defaulting to `$HOME/.config` if unset.

The `n34 sets` command allows managing sets, adding, removing, updating,
or displaying them. When using the main `--relays` flag, a set name can
be provided to automatically expand its relays (an error occurs if the
set contains no relays). Similarly, any command accepting naddrs can
reference a set to extract its naddrs.

Sets can also be merged by updating a set while specifying another
set in `--repo` merges their naddrs, while `--set-relays` merges their
relays. Removal follows the same pattern.
